P22 Title Fee

As a commercial real estate business, you are probably aware of P22 title fees and all that it entails. However, for those of you who are unsure, here is a quick overview: A P22 title fee is the fee that is paid to an attorney in Texas who is not licensed to act as an escrow officer, but who has the ability to close a real estate transaction in the name of a law firm. This is allowed under Procedural Rule P-22 of the Texas Department of Insurance, which is unique to the state of Texas.
